Harare Man Caught with 14kgs Dagga

Londile Moyo, [email protected]

A 33-year-old man from Harare has been arraigned by the Harare Magistrates’ court for unlawful possession of drugs. Allegedly, the incident happened on 2 June 2025, at approximately 21:30 hours, Wobert Gumbo was observed by detectives from the Criminal Investigation Department Drugs and Narcotics on Simone Road, Harare.

According to the National Prosecuting Authority of Zimbabwe (NPAZ), Gumbo was seen with two white socks, sitting on one and examining the contents of the other with his mobile phone’s light. The detectives, who were on routine highway patrol, approached Gumbo, identified themselves, and requested to search his sacks for dangerous drugs. They recovered fourteen 1-kilogram vacuum-sealed transparent plastic packets of dagga.

The accused person was arrested and transported with the recovered drugs to CID.
